Abstract

A tool for removing dents includes a first upper handle extending transversely and connected to a first downwardly extending rigid bar portion and a second lower handle extending transversely and connected to a second upwardly extending rigid bar portion, both portions interconnect a first lateral rigid bar portion disposed in a first X-Y plane between the first upper handle and the second lower handle. The handles are both on a first side of a second Y-Z plane and the handles extend generally in an opposing Z direction from one another. A second rigid upper bar portion extends generally in a Z direction opposing forming a U shape between the downwardly extending rigid bar portions, and the second rigid upper bar portion is on a second side of the second Y-Z plane. A rigid nose head extends from an end of the second rigid bar portion in a selectable fixable position.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A tool for removing dents, which comprises:
 a rigid member having a first upper handle extending transversely and connected to a first downwardly extending rigid bar portion and a second lower handle extending transversely and connected to a second upwardly extending rigid bar portion, said first downwardly extending rigid bar portion and said second upwardly extending rigid bar portion interconnect a first end of a first lateral rigid bar portion disposed in a first X-Y plane between said first upper handle and said second lower handle and wherein said first lateral rigid bar portion extends laterally outwardly to a second end thereof, and a second Y-Z plane is defined through said first lateral rigid bar portion normal to said first X-Y plane and said handles are both on a first side of said second Y-Z plane wherein said first upper handle and said second lower handle extend generally in an opposing Z direction from one another;   a second rigid upper bar portion connects to said second end of said first lateral bar portion and extends generally in a Z direction opposing said downwardly extending rigid bar portion thus forming a U shape between said downwardly extending rigid bar portion, said first lateral rigid bar portion and said second rigid upper bar portion, and said second rigid upper bar portion is on a second side of said second Y-Z plane; and   a rigid nose head extending from an end of said second rigid bar portion.   
     
     
         2 . The tool of  claim 1 , wherein said rigid nose head extends inward generally in a direction toward said second Y-Z plane. 
     
     
         3 . The tool of  claim 1 , wherein said rigid nose head extends outward generally in a direction away from said second Y-Z plane. 
     
     
         4 . The tool of  claim 1 , wherein said rigid nose head includes a rounded aspect. 
     
     
         5 . The tool of  claim 1 , wherein said handles are one of integrally and separately connected as part of respective rigid handle bar portions and extend in a generally Y direction relative to said first X-Y plane. 
     
     
         6 . The tool of  claim 1 , wherein said rigid nose head is removably connected to said second second rigid upper bar portion. 
     
     
         7 . The tool of  claim 6 , wherein said end of said second rigid bar portion includes one of a threaded and a polygonal receiving surface for a complementary formed end of said rigid nose head. 
     
     
         8 . The tool of  claim 1 , wherein said handles include an enhanced gripping surface. 
     
     
         9 . The tool of  claim 6 , which includes a collar having a detent mechanism employed adjacent said second end of said second rigid upper bar portion to assist in removably receipt of a shank of said rigid nose head. 
     
     
         10 . A tool for removing dents, which comprises:
 a rigid member having a first upper handle extending transversely and connected to a first downwardly extending rigid bar portion and a second lower handle extending transversely and connected to a second upwardly extending rigid bar portion, said first downwardly extending rigid bar portion and said second upwardly extending rigid bar portion interconnect a first end of a first lateral rigid bar portion disposed in a first X-Y plane between said first upper handle and said second lower handle and wherein said first lateral rigid bar portion extends laterally outwardly to a second end thereof, and a second Y-Z plane is defined through said first lateral rigid bar portion normal to said first X-Y plane and said handles are both on a first side of said second Y-Z plane wherein said first upper handle and said second lower handle extend generally in an opposing Z direction from one another;   a second rigid upper bar portion connects to said second end of said first lateral bar portion and extends generally in a Z direction opposing said downwardly extending rigid bar portion thus forming a U shape between said downwardly extending rigid bar portion, said first lateral rigid bar portion and said second rigid upper bar portion, and said second rigid upper bar portion is on a second side of said second Y-Z plane; and   a rigid nose head removably connected to and extending from an end of said second rigid bar portion.   
     
     
         11 . The tool of  claim 10 , which includes a collar having a detent mechanism employed adjacent said second end of said second rigid upper bar portion to assist in removably receipt of a shank of said rigid nose head. 
     
     
         12 . The tool of  claim 11 , wherein said end of said second rigid bar portion includes one of a threaded and a polygonal receiving surface for a complementary formed end of said rigid nose head. 
     
     
         13 . The tool of  claim 10 , wherein said handles are one of integrally and separately connected as part of respective rigid handle bar portions and extend in a generally Y direction relative to said first X-Y plane.
